Time the record covers
At most 4.1 million years on record.
The one occurrence read is dated to somewhere between 449.6 Mya and 445.5 Mya, which is a dating window rather than a span.
1 occurrence of Archinacella rugatina on record, most of them in the Ordovician. Bar height is expected occurrences, not a count: each fossil is spread across the span it is dated to, so a tall narrow bar means tight dating and a low wide one means loose.
